WebOther stems are compressed, with short distances between buds or leaves. Examples include crowns of strawberry plants, fruit spurs and African violets. ... These are shortened, compressed underground stems surrounded by fleshy scales (leaves) that envelop a central bud at the tip of the stem. In November, you can cut a tulip or daffodil bulb in ... WebBulbs have a greatly reduced stem with thick fleshy scale leaves surrounding it (as in the onion). WebThey have short internodes with prominent buds. The underground parts have small, colorless leaflike structures. Tuber Tubers are greatly enlarged fleshy stems with compressed internodes. Tubers are store organs for nutrient reserves. They can also be used for propagation. Cut off one of the leaves at its base, then cut it into 2-4 inch segments. Dip the basal end (the end of the segment that was closest to the base of the plant) of each segment in rooting hormone and then insert 1-2 inches into the rooting mix. minigolf tour gameWebBulb is a short underground stem with fleshy leaf base called scales. Stem is very much reduced and becomes disc like. The discoid stem in convex or conical in shape and bears highly compressed internodes. These node bear fleshy scales. The Crocosmia corm has a thick, expanded stem stores starch, and the leaves that surround it are non-photosynthetic and papery. The onion bulb has a relatively small stem surrounded by thick, fleshy leaves.
